Straighten Pearly Whites and Improve Bite
Align your teeth and improve your bite with orthodontic care. Crooked or misaligned teeth not just affect your look but can also have a negative impact on your general oral health.
Orthodontic therapy, such as braces or aligners, can aid deal with these issues and give you a lovely smile.
When your teeth are effectively aligned, it comes to be simpler to cleanse them, reducing the threat of dental caries and gum illness. On top of that, a proper bite guarantees that your teeth fulfill evenly, minimizing the deterioration on your teeth and lowering the opportunities of developing issues with your jaw joints.

Protect Against Oral Issues
To avoid oral problems, routine orthodontic care is crucial for maintaining optimum oral health and wellness. Below are three reasons why it's important:
1. Proper Positioning: Misaligned teeth can develop rooms and voids where food bits can get entraped, leading to plaque build-up and a raised danger of dental caries and periodontal illness. Orthodontic treatment, such as braces or clear aligners, can straighten your teeth appropriately, making it simpler to cleanse and lowering the possibilities of dental issues.
2. Bite Improvement: An inappropriate bite can put extreme pressure on particular teeth, creating damage, jaw discomfort, and even headaches. Orthodontic treatment can correct your bite, distributing the force equally and avoiding dental problems connected to attack concerns.
3. Improved Oral Hygiene: Crooked or crowded teeth can make it testing to clean and floss properly, leaving areas untouched and prone to degeneration. Aligning your teeth through orthodontic therapy can improve your oral health regimen, making it easier to keep your teeth and periodontals clean and healthy.
